NAND Power: Downgrade 2025 performance expectations with an expected loss of 890 million to 1.25 billion yuan.
Nandu Power disclosed a revised forecast for its performance in 2025, expecting a loss of 2.4 to 2.8 billion yuan, compared to the previous forecast of a loss of 0.89 to 1.25 billion yuan. In the same period last year, the company reported a loss of 1.497 billion yuan. The reason for the revision in performance is due to the long-term impact of the mismatch between the prices of waste batteries and lead. Nandu's wholly-owned subsidiary, Huabo Recycling Resources, has been under continued pressure and in sustained losses. The company has decided to agree to cease operations of Huabo Recycling Resources and will make full provision for impairment of long-term assets such as buildings, machinery, and equipment under its name, with an estimated impairment amount of about 1.3 billion yuan. The company is facing tight liquidity, with delivery of orders being hindered. The company is optimizing and adjusting its business model, and these adjustments may have a significant impact on the operational efficiency and future profit levels of some entities.
